The opportunity;
We are delighted to be working with a highly successful organisation in search of a critical role for their leadership team, to lead their people function and take the business on the next phase of it's journey.
As Interim Head of People, you’ll provide steady, credible leadership to an established people function during a planned transition This role is all about maintaining momentum, supporting and leading a strong team, and making thoughtful, incremental improvements where they count.
Based onsite in Cheshire, this is a 9 month contract (part time may be considered for 4 days).
Key Responsibilities;
- The Interim Head of People will;
- Provide continuity and stability across the leadership and people teams.
- Step into an established people function and ensure smooth day-to-day operations.
- Oversee Talent, People Partnering and Culture, provide leadership and direction.
- Maintain and nurture company culture, ensuring they are lived across the leadership teams, driving high performance and high trust.
- Partner with senior leadership, working closely with executive stakeholders to support organisational wellbeing and performance and acting as a trusted advisor on people-related matters.
- Act as a visible, on-site leader and build relationships quickly across the business.
